I received an e-mail from cron with the following error message:

/etc/cron.weekly/efax:
find: /var/log/fax: No such file or directory

An indeed, /etc/cron.weekly/efax contains:

  find /var/log/fax

whereas the directory where logs are kept is /var/log/efax/.
